On Monday 26 May 2008, hsanson wrote: > I use FIND_PROGRAM to find a grammar parser (ragel) to generate some > source files needed for my project. The problem is that the way ragel is > called (arguments) is different for each mayor version. I need to get > the program mayor version 5.x or 6.x and then set the ADD_COMMAND > arguments accordingly but I have not found a portable way (works in > linux and windows) way to do this. > > Does CMake has something like FIND_PROGRAM but that accepts or provides > the program version information??
No. You have to find the program, run it e.g. with --version, evaluate the output, and proceed depending on what you get, e.g. try to find another version, use another set of add_custom_command() etc. Alex _______________________________________________ CMake mailing list CMake@cmake.org http://www.cmake.org/mailman/listinfo/cmake
